Research on the effects of feedback interventions. Feedback is not always beneficial for learning; in some cases, it can actually depress performance.
<p>The MCPL literature suggests that for an FI to directly improve learning, rather than motivate learning, it has to help the recipient to <em>reject erroneous hypotheses.</em> Whereas correcting errors is a feature of some types of FI messages, most types of FI messages do not contain such information and therefore should not improve learning—a claim consistent with CAI research.</p> <p>Moreover, even in learning situations where performance seems to benefit from FIs, learning through <em>FIs may be inferior to learning through discovery</em> (learning based on feedback from the task, rather than on feedback from an external agent). Task feedback may force the participant to learn task rules and recognize errors (e.g., Frese &amp; Zapf, 1994), whereas FI may lead the participant to learn how to use the FI as a crutch, while shortcutting the need for task learning (cf. J. R. Anderson, 1987). </p>
In the MCPL literature, several reviewers doubt whether FIs have any learning value (Balzer et al., 1989; Brehmer, 1980) and suggest alternatives to FI for increasing learning, such as providing the learner with more task information (Balzer et al., 1989). Another alternative to an FI is designing work or learning<br> environments that encourage trial and error, thus maximizing learning from task feedback without a direct intervention (Frese &amp; Zapf, 1994).

Review of Bloom's Taxonomy, including problems and the revised version, with information about the differences between factual, conceptual, procedural, and metacognitive knowledge.
Those teachers who keep a list of question prompts relating to the various levels of Bloom’s Taxonomy undoubtedly do a better job of encouraging higher-order thinking in their students than those who have no such tool. On the other hand, as anyone who has worked with a group of educators to classify a group of questions and learning activities according to the Taxonomy can attest, there is little consensus about what seemingly self-evident terms like “analysis,” or “evaluation” mean. In addition, so many worthwhile activities, such as authentic problems and projects, cannot be mapped to the Taxonomy, and trying to do that would diminish their potential as learning opportunities.

Criticism of Bloom's Taxonomy, with two alternatives for classifying objectives
The categories or “levels” of Bloom’s taxonomy (knowledge, comprehension, application, analysis, synthesis, and evaluation) are not supported by any research on learning. The only distinction that is supported by research is the distinction between declarative/conceptual knowledge (which enables recall, comprehension, or understanding) and procedural knowledge (which enables application or task performance).

Review of research and claims about digital natives, recommending critical research and real discussion rather than "dismissive scepticism [or] uncritical advocacy."
<div class="para"><p>The claim that there is a distinctive new generation of students in possession of sophisticated technology skills and with learning preferences for which education is not equipped to support has excited much recent attention. Proponents arguing that education must change dramatically to cater for the needs of these digital natives have sparked an academic form of a ‘moral panic’ using extreme arguments that have lacked empirical evidence.</p></div><div class="para"><p>The picture beginning to emerge from research on young people's relationships with technology is much more complex than the digital native characterisation suggests. While technology is embedded in their lives, young people's use and skills are not uniform. There is no evidence of widespread and universal disaffection, or of a distinctly different learning style the like of which has never been seen before. </p></div>

Research summary on a specific model for spaced learning which the author found effective for improving recall
The Modified Low-First Method is an optimal spaced learning method which was derived from a reactivation theory of spacing effects and was designed to be effective by setting as advantageous spaces as possible for all items and for any learners with various working memory capacities. It consists of three principles; the first is to sort all items by their probabilities of recall in ascending order at the end of each learning session for the subsequent session, and the second is to omit items whose probabilities of recall have reached a certain level, and the third is to transit to a new learning session when the number of unrecalled items in a session have reached a certain number.

Research comparing training spaced over multiple weeks versus an intense burst of training in two days. Not a controlled study, but promising results for spaced learning.
<em>Purpose</em> – <it>The purpose of this paper is to compare the impact of a long-term (13-week, spaced learning) with a short-term (two-day, block intensive) coaching skills training programme on participants' coaching skills and emotional intelligence.</it>
<em>Findings</em> – <it>Participation in the 13-week training course was associated with increases in both goal-focused coaching skills and emotional intelligence, whereas the two-day block intensive training was associated with increased goal-focused coaching skills, but not emotional intelligence. Further, the magnitude of the increase in goal-focused coaching skills was less for the two-day programme than for the 13-week programme.</it>

Explanation of cognitive load theory and the problems with it, both conceptual and methodological. Lots of sources to dig into deeper if you want more research on this issue.
Numerous contradictions of cognitive load theory’s predictions have been found, but with germane cognitive load, they can still be explained away.&nbsp; de Jong does not use this term (unfalsifiable) but instead states that germane cognitive load is a <em>post-hoc</em> explanation with no theoretical basis: “there seems to be no grounds for asserting that processes that lead to (correct) schema acquisition will impose a higher cognitive load than learning processes that do not lead to (correct) schemas” (2009).
2. <span style="text-decoration: underline;">Poor external validity of lab-based studies</span>.&nbsp; Moreno doesn’t touch on something in the de Jong article – the fact that most cognitive load (and multimedia learning) studies are conducted in labs that “includes participants who have no specific interest in learning the domain involved and who are also given a very short study time” (de Jong, 2009), often only a few minutes.&nbsp; Quite a number of findings from these studies have not held up as strongly when tested in classrooms or real-world scenarios, or have even reversed (<a href="http://www.txwes.edu/professionaldevelopment/materials/Multimedia%20Instructions.pdf">such as the modality effect</a>, but see <a href="http://dx.doi.org/10.1016/j.learninstruc.2007.09.010">this refutation</a> and this <a href="http://cat.inist.fr/?aModele=afficheN&amp;cpsidt=5135499">other example of a reverse effect</a>).
